Blue Strips Meaning in Text
In texting slang, “blue strips” usually refers to blue-colored counterfeit pills, often discussed in online drug slang conversations. The phrase is not an official acronym or abbreviation. Instead, it’s more of a slang expression used casually online.
People sometimes use the term indirectly to avoid saying the actual drug name in public posts or chats. Social media users often replace direct words with coded slang to avoid moderation filters or platform restrictions.
In everyday conversations, someone might use the phrase while talking about partying, street slang, music culture, or internet memes. However, not everyone using the term is serious. Sometimes people mention it jokingly or reference it because they saw it trending online.
The meaning can also depend on the platform and the people involved in the conversation.

Is Blue Strips Rude or Offensive?
The phrase itself is not automatically rude, but it can be associated with sensitive topics depending on how people use it.
Because the slang is sometimes connected to drug-related conversations, it may not be appropriate for professional settings, classrooms, or formal discussions.
Using the phrase casually among friends online is different from using it at work or school. Context matters a lot.
If you are unsure whether others will understand the meaning, it’s usually safer to avoid using the term in serious environments.

Origin of the Term
The exact origin of the slang is somewhat unclear, but it likely developed from internet culture mixed with street slang and music references.
Online communities often create coded language to avoid moderation systems or to sound more exclusive within certain groups.
Rap music, TikTok trends, and meme culture have helped spread similar slang expressions very quickly across social media platforms.
Because internet slang evolves constantly, meanings can shift over time or vary between communities.
Some users may even use the phrase incorrectly because they learned it from memes without fully understanding the original meaning.
